Local priorities
The following priorities have been identified by the community and the police:
- Burglary (All types). We will be focusing on reducing all types of burglaries in the area by providing crime prevention advice to ensure that residents, their homes and property do not become targets. We will be conducting high visibility patrols in problem areas.
- Metal Thefts. These types of thefts are on the rise due to the increase in the price of metal. We will be working with the rural communities who are particularly affected by this type of crime to deal with any suspicious activity or vehicles reported to us.
- Anti-Social Behaviour (ASB). ASB is still a concern of residents in the area. We are still focusing our patrols in hotspot areas and dealing robustly with offenders.
These are being dealt with by your neighbourhood policing team in partnership with residents and other agencies. Progress will be reported in the Neighbourhood updates.
